Browse nicknames →The Story of Addelyn
Addelyn is a modern American spelling variant of Adeline, which derives from the Germanic element 'adal' meaning noble. Adeline itself is a diminutive of Adele or Adelaide, names long beloved in European aristocracy. The -lyn ending modernizes the classical French form, bridging old-world elegance with contemporary appeal.
Adeline and its variants have enjoyed a sustained revival since the 2000s, fueled by the neo-Victorian naming trend and the song 'Sweet Adeline' (1903) that has kept the name in cultural consciousness. Addelyn is among the newest spelling variants, appealing to parents who love the sound but want a fresher visual identity.
Adelaide and Adeline were royal names across medieval Europe — Queen Adelaide of Saxe-Meiningen was consort of King William IV of England. The name carries aristocratic French and German heritage, evoking castles, poetry, and refinement.
Historical Record
Addelyn first appeared in US Social Security records in 2001.
Over 2,615 babies have been named Addelyn in the United States since SSA records began.
Today, Addelyn is a hidden gem — rare but distinctive , currently ranked #1,948 for girl names in the US .
Fun Facts
- 'Sweet Adeline (My Adeline),' written in 1903, was sung by barbershop quartets for decades and became one of America's most beloved folk songs
- Queen Adelaide of Saxe-Meiningen (1792–1849) was consort of King William IV; the Australian city of Adelaide was named in her honor

About the Name Addelyn
Addelyn is a girl name with American, English, and French origins . The name means "noble, nobility" in Germanic .
Addelyn is currently ranked #1,948 in popularity for girl names in the United States.
The name Addelyn has 3 syllables, making it distinctive and memorable.
Common nicknames for Addelyn include Addie, Addy, and Lynnie. These shorter forms provide casual alternatives while keeping the elegance of the full name.
